The best box ever

Obi and Oliver have a favorite box. It is the perfect size for napping. It is upholstered in a fabric that is pleasant to scratch. And it has a lid that folds over for a hammock-like feel.

Best of all, this box appears for limited engagements. The fact that it goes away makes it all the more fabulous when it returns.

The cost of getting to spend time with this special box is that The Boy has to go away. You see, this box is his suitcase. It comes out of his closet the day before a trip. It stays out for several days after he returns.

But as long as The Girl doesn’t get her suitcase out, they seem to think this is a price worth paying. It is a most excellent box. For whoever gets there first in the evening, it is a preferred location for night long slumber no matter how many times The Girl calls.

The Boy came back from his trip Sunday night. The box was still out when I left Wednesday morning. Maybe The Boy will take pity on Kitten Thunder and leave the box out until I return.

Small comforts.
